Summary on Grant Application Form
Novel scandium phosphates, phosphonates and silicates will be prepared via hydrothermal syntheses in the presence of inorganic and/or organic templating agents where appropriate. Scandium possesses very promising properties as a framework forming element, but has previously been largely overlooked due to cost. New sources of commercially available scandium open up the possibility of extended research. As a part of the project the speciation of scandium in a range of aqueous solutions will be examined. The resultant microporous solids will be structurally characterised by single crystal and powder X-ray diffraction, solid state NMR (scandium-45 possesses favourable NMR properties) and high resolution electron microscopy and electron diffraction. The potential utility of scandium-containing solids as selective cation exchangers and molecular sieves will be measured.
